Job Description

We’re looking for a highly organised and experienced Senior Office Administrator / Operations Manager to support the day-to-day running of our Dublin office. This is a fixed term contract running until the end of the year and will best suit an experienced office administrator who is looking to take on more strategic responsibilities. As the key point of contact for administrative operations across all departments, this role is central to ensuring an efficient, professional, and well-supported working environment. You’ll oversee a team of four administrative professionals, provide high-level support to senior leadership and work closely with colleagues in our regional offices.

Key Responsibilities

Office & Administrative Leadership

  • Act as the go-to person for all administrative and coordination needs across the Dublin office

  • Provide direct executive support to senior leadership, including diary management, travel coordination, and document preparation

  • Organise team meetings, internal events, and external client functions, including logistics, agendas, minutes, and follow-up actions

  • Coordinate internal reporting, including WIP, debtors, and pitch tracking

  • Manage systems, databases, and internal tools (including SAM) to support office-wide activity

Team Supervision & Development

  • Lead and support a team of four Administrative Assistants, overseeing daily workload and performance

  • Set clear priorities and objectives for the team, ensuring consistent delivery of high-quality admin support

  • Coach and mentor team members, providing regular feedback and supporting development plans

Operational Coordination

  • Identify opportunities to streamline processes and implement more efficient systems across the office

  • Liaise closely with regional office counterparts to align processes and share best practices

  • Manage general office duties such as maintaining supplies, coordinating leave records, handling expenses, and responding to internal queries

  • Ensure the office operates smoothly and professionally, upholding a consistent standard of service across all departments

Skills, Qualifications & Experience

  • Minimum 4 years' experience in a senior administrative or office coordination role, ideally within a professional services or commercial real estate environment

  • Willing to be full office based initially

  • Strong leadership and team management capabilities

  • Exceptionally well-organised, with the ability to multitask and manage priorities independently

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ills – both written and verbal

  • Proficient in Microsoft Office (advanced skills in PowerPoint, Word, Excel)

  • Experience working with bespoke systems such as SAM, Workday, CRM tools, or similar platforms is an advantage

  • A third-level qualification is preferred but not essential

What you need to know about the Dublin Tech Scene

From Bono and Oscar Wilde to today's tech leaders, Dublin has always attracted trailblazers, with more than 70,000 people working in the city's expanding digital sector. Continuing its legacy of drawing pioneers, the city is advancing rapidly. Ireland is now ranked as one of the top tech clusters in the region and the number one destination for digital companies, with the highest hiring intention of any region across all sectors.
